Generalising uncertainty improves accuracy and safety of deep learning analytics applied to oncology
2022-07-16
Abstract excerpt
Trust and transparency are critical for deploying deep learning (DL) models into the clinic. DL application poses generalisation obstacles since training/development datasets often have different data distributions to clinical/production datasets that can lead to incorrect predictions with underestimated uncertainty. To investigate this pitfall, we benchmarked one pointwise and three approximate Bayesian DL models...
